Understanding the Hen: A Guide to Female Turkeys

Many people assume that all birds look alike, but understanding the hen is key to appreciating these remarkable creatures. Recognizing a hen from a gobbler can be surprisingly straightforward – they generally don't have the bright, iridescent plumage found on the males. Hens are typically duller in appearance , often exhibiting earthy tones and grays . Their behavior also differs; while toms large turkeys for sale frequently gobble to attract mates , hens tend to cluck and focus more on searching for food and looking after their young . Observing these subtle variations enhances one’s knowledge of turkey interactions .

The Beauty of White Turkeys: A Rare Sight

Witnessing a white turkey is a remarkably rare sight, a testament to nature's quirks. These birds, unlike their more common russet relatives, possess a stunning plumage of pure white, making them appear like ethereal creatures. The color results from a recessive genetic characteristic , meaning both parents must carry the gene for a chick to be born lacking pigment. Such a visual encounter is a privilege for any birdwatcher and serves as a touching reminder of the loveliness found in unexpected places within the wild world.

Turkey Chicks 101: Caring for Your Young Flock Additions

Bringing little turkey babies home is a exciting experience, but it also demands attentive attention. Initially , they need a draft-free brooder, which can be a spacious plastic bin or even a sturdy box. The environment should be around 95°F (35°C) directly under the heat light and gradually lowered by 5°F (2.8°C) each seven days until they are fully feathered. Providing fresh water and appropriate chick crumble is vital for strong growth. Don't forget grit to aid in breaking down food.

Consider this a quick overview to ensure their health :

  • Maintain a sanitary brooder.
  • Supply fresh water each day .
  • Check they have enough room to explore.
  • Monitor them carefully for any indications of illness .
  • Gently introduce them to the free-range area when conditions permit.

Female Turkey Behavior: Nesting

The breeding cycle for female turkeys, or hens, is fascinating . After mating , the hen will start searching for a suitable nesting site , often under shrubs, plants, or low-lying cover. She will diligently create a bed using leaves and vegetation . Once the laying period is complete, the hen goes a brooding stage , diligently sitting the clutch for approximately 28 days . During this phase, she rarely leaves the nest, relying on reserved fat reserves for energy. She defends the nest from likely threats and vocalizes with soft sounds to ensure the clutch at the optimal heat.
